diff --git a/libjava/gnu/gcj/jvmti/ExceptionEvent.java b/libjava/gnu/gcj/jvmti/ExceptionEvent.java
new file mode 100644 (file)
index 0000000..26ddec2
--- /dev/null
@@ -0,0 +1,96 @@
+// ExceptionEvent - an exception event for JVMTI
+
+/* Copyright (C) 2007  Free Software Foundation
+
+   This file is part of libgcj.
+
+This software is copyrighted work licensed under the terms of the
+Libgcj License.  Please consult the file "LIBGCJ_LICENSE" for
+details.  */
+
+package gnu.gcj.jvmti;
+
+import java.util.WeakHashMap;
+
+/**
+ * Class to create and send JVMTI Exception events
+ *
+ * @author Kyle Galloway (kgallowa@redhat.com)
+ */
+public class ExceptionEvent
+{
+  // Information about where the exception was thrown
+  private long _throwMeth, _throwLoc;
+  
+  // Information about where the exception was or can be caught
+  private long _catchMeth, _catchLoc;
+  
+  // Thread where the exception occurred
+  private Thread _thread;
+  
+  // The exception
+  private Throwable _ex;
+  
+  // A hash map of the exceptions we've already seen in a thread's call stack
+  private static WeakHashMap<Thread, Throwable> _exMap = new WeakHashMap<Thread, Throwable>();
+  
+  /**
+   * Constructs a new ExceptionEvent and sends it.  If it is not caught
+   * within the frame where it was thrown (catchMeth and catchLoc are null),
+   * check_catch will check for a possible catch further up the call stack 
+   * before marking it uncaught.
+   * 
+   * @param thr the thread where the exception occurred
+   * @param throwMeth the method of the throw (a jmethodID)
+   * @param throwLoc the location of the throw (a jlocation)
+   * @param ex the exception
+   * @param catchMeth the method of the catch (a jmethodID), null indicates
+   * that the exception was not caught in the frame where it was thrown
+   * @param catchLoc the location of the catch (a jlocation), null indicates
+   * that the exception was not caught in the frame where it was thrown
+   */
+  private ExceptionEvent(Thread thr, long throwMeth, long throwLoc,
+                                Throwable ex, long catchMeth, long catchLoc)
+  {
+    this._thread = thr;
+    this._ex = ex;
+    this._throwMeth = throwMeth;
+    this._throwLoc = throwLoc;
+    this._catchMeth = catchMeth;
+    this._catchLoc = catchLoc;
+  }
+  
+  public static void postExceptionEvent(Thread thr, long throwMeth,
+                                               long throwLoc, Throwable ex,
+                                               long catchMeth, long catchLoc)
+  {
+    // Check to see if there is an entry for this Thread thr in the has map.
+       // If not, add the thread to the hash map and send an ExceptionEvent.
+       if (_exMap.containsKey(thr))
+         {
+               // Check to see if we are receiving events for the same exception, or a
+               // new one.  If it is not the same exception beign rethrown, send a new
+               // event.
+           if (!(_exMap.get(thr) == ex))
+             {
+            _exMap.put(thr, ex);
+            ExceptionEvent event = new ExceptionEvent(thr, throwMeth,
+                                                         throwLoc, ex, catchMeth,
+                                                         catchLoc);  
+            event.sendEvent ();
+          }
+         }
+       else
+         {
+           _exMap.put(thr, ex);
+           ExceptionEvent event = new ExceptionEvent(thr, throwMeth,
+                                                  throwLoc, ex, catchMeth,
+                                                  catchLoc);
+           event.sendEvent();
+         }
+  }
+  
+  public native void sendEvent();
+  
+  public native void checkCatch();
+}
diff --git a/libjava/gnu/gcj/jvmti/natExceptionEvent.cc b/libjava/gnu/gcj/jvmti/natExceptionEvent.cc
new file mode 100644 (file)
index 0000000..dfc8e66
--- /dev/null
@@ -0,0 +1,59 @@
+// natExceptionEvent.cc - C++ code for JVMTI Exception events
+
+/* Copyright (C) 2007  Free Software Foundation
+
+   This file is part of libgcj.
+
+This software is copyrighted work licensed under the terms of the
+Libgcj License.  Please consult the file "LIBGCJ_LICENSE" for
+details.  */
+
+#include <config.h>
+#include <gcj/cni.h>
+#include <gcj/method.h>
+#include <java-interp.h>
+#include <java-insns.h>
+#include <java-assert.h>
+#include <jvmti.h>
+#include <jvmti-int.h>
+
+#include <gnu/gcj/jvmti/ExceptionEvent.h>
+
+void
+gnu::gcj::jvmti::ExceptionEvent::sendEvent ()
+{
+  // Check if the exception is caught somewhere in the interpreted call stack
+  if (_catchMeth == 0 || _catchLoc == 0)
+    checkCatch ();
+    
+  JNIEnv *jni = _Jv_GetCurrentJNIEnv ();
+
+  _Jv_JVMTI_PostEvent (JVMTI_EVENT_EXCEPTION, _thread, jni,
+                       reinterpret_cast<jmethodID> (_throwMeth),
+                       static_cast<jlocation> (_throwLoc), _ex,
+                       reinterpret_cast<jmethodID> (_catchMeth),
+                       static_cast<jlocation> (_catchLoc)); 
+}
+
+// This method looks up the interpreted call stack to see if the exception will
+// eventually be caught by some java method.
+void
+gnu::gcj::jvmti::ExceptionEvent::checkCatch ()
+{
+  _Jv_InterpFrame *frame 
+    = reinterpret_cast<_Jv_InterpFrame *> (_thread->interp_frame);
+  
+  while ((frame = frame->next_interp))
+    {
+         _Jv_InterpMethod *meth 
+           = reinterpret_cast<_Jv_InterpMethod *> (frame->self);
+         pc_t pc = frame->pc;
+               
+         if (meth->check_handler (&pc, meth, _ex))
+           {
+             _catchMeth = reinterpret_cast<jlong> (meth->get_method ());
+             _catchLoc = meth->insn_index (pc);
+          break;
+           }
+    }
+}

+// Method to check if an exception is caught at some location in a method
+// (meth).  Returns true if this method (meth) contains a catch block for the
+// exception (ex). False otherwise.  If there is a catch block, it sets the pc
+// to the location of the beginning of the catch block.
+jboolean
+_Jv_InterpMethod::check_handler (pc_t *pc, _Jv_InterpMethod *meth,
+                                java::lang::Throwable *ex)
+{
+#ifdef DIRECT_THREADED
+  void *logical_pc = (void *) ((insn_slot *) (*pc) - 1);
+#else
+  int logical_pc = (*pc) - 1 - meth->bytecode ();
+#endif
+  _Jv_InterpException *exc = meth->exceptions ();
+  jclass exc_class = ex->getClass ();
+
+  for (int i = 0; i < meth->exc_count; i++)
+    {
+      if (PCVAL (exc[i].start_pc) <= logical_pc
+          && logical_pc < PCVAL (exc[i].end_pc))
+        {
+#ifdef DIRECT_THREADED
+              jclass handler = (jclass) exc[i].handler_type.p;
+#else
+              jclass handler = NULL;
+              if (exc[i].handler_type.i != 0)
+                    handler
+                      = (_Jv_Linker::resolve_pool_entry (meth->defining_class,
+                                                                             ex$
+#endif /* DIRECT_THREADED */
+              if (handler == NULL || handler->isAssignableFrom (exc_class))
+                {
+#ifdef DIRECT_THREADED
+                  (*pc) = (insn_slot *) exc[i].handler_pc.p;
+#else
+                  (*pc) = meth->bytecode () + exc[i].handler_pc.i;
+#endif /* DIRECT_THREADED */
+                  return true;
+                }
+          }
+      }
+  return false;
+}
